Occupancy of beds Sensors are tools used to determine whether or not a bed is occupied. These sensors are frequently used in hospitals and nursing homes as well as other healthcare institutions to monitor patient conditions and guarantee their safety.
Occupancy of beds Pressure sensors, motion sensors, and infrared sensors are just a few of the technologies that sensors can utilize to find out if someone is on the bed.
The sensors can detect the weight or movement of a person on the bed and are often installed under the mattress or in the bed frame.
The information gathered by the bed occupancy sensors can be utilized for a number of things, including automating some actions like turning on the lights or regulating the temperature in the room and monitoring the condition of patients who are at risk of falling or who need frequent monitoring.
In conclusion, bed occupancy sensors are a useful tool for medical personnel who wish to guarantee the security and welfare of their patients, and they can enhance the standard of care delivered in healthcare facilities.

A cooperative business development agreement between Ricoh Company, Ltd. and MinebeaMitsumi Inc. was signed.
Since then, the "Bed Sensor SystemTM" has been created and commercialized in collaboration by the two parties. To further enhance the Bed Sensor System product range, MinebeaMitsumi will proudly announce the introduction of a new model called "Bed Sensor System Basic".
In this new model, functions like "measurement of referential body weight" and "warning alarm emission when detecting the patient leaving bed" will be prioritized because they have received the most demand from the market.
The "Bed Sensor System" is a product that uses sensor systems that are placed beneath the bed legs and are simple to install to take care of patients.
High-precision monitoring of the patient's status and essential data is made possible by the sensor system. Because the sensors are positioned beneath the bed legs, they have a very low profile and don't draw the patient's attention.
The patients are therefore guaranteed to lead regular lives without being troubled by the perception that they are being watched.
